			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>I flew from Hong Kong to London last Thursday with <a href="http://www.oasishongkong.com/" title="Oasis Hong Kong - Budget airline from Hong Kong to London or Vancouver" target="_blank">Oasis</a>. The flight was very pleasant indeed. We left Hong Kong&#8217;s wonderful airport, with free wifi throughout, around 1am, and landed early in London about 6:30am. The flight was about 13 hours, so you get a chance to sleep while arriving early in the morning. It&#8217;s pretty painless.</p>
<p>The airline itself was very impressive for a budget carrier. The flight cost £105. They served a light evening meal before turning off the cabin lights and a light breakfast shortly before we arrived in London. I hadn&#8217;t expected any food at all.  Additional refreshments were available, and seemed reasonably priced. A can of beer was £2, most snacks were £1.</p>
<p>Overall, I was impressed, I&#8217;d definitely fly with Oasis again. Now they also fly to Vancouver from Hong Kong.</p>
